Taxonomic Classification

Rank Conglomerate Pachyphloeus Large-eared Hutia
Kingdom Fungi (Fungi)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Ascomycota (Sac Fungi) Chordata (Chordates)
Class Pezizomycetes (Pezizomycetes)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Pezizales (Pezizales) Rodentia (Rodents)
Family Pezizaceae Capromyidae
Genus Pachyphlodes Mesocapromys
Species Pachyphlodes conglomerata Mesocapromys auritus
